Step-up and step-down power transformers serve as the bedrock of Samara’s energy conversion ecosystem. Step-up transformers are essential at regional generation sites—including hydroelectric installations and thermal cogeneration facilities—to elevate voltage for low-loss transmission across the regional 110kV and 35kV transmission grids. Conversely, industrial consumers, specialized fabrication plants, and municipal utility networks rely on step-down transformers to reduce incoming high voltages to usable 10kV, 6kV, 400V, 380V, and 220V levels with total electromagnetic stability.
Technical Insight for Samara Procurement Managers: Power transformers deployed in Samara must incorporate cold-resistant insulation materials, high flash-point transformer oils (or advanced epoxy resin cast dry-type insulation), and low-loss cold-rolled grain-oriented (CRGO) silicon steel cores to maintain efficiency during severe atmospheric conditions.
The global power transformer market is undergoing an unprecedented structural transition driven by grid modernization, electrification of industrial processes, and the integration of renewable energy sources. Modern industrial end-users no longer seek basic electrical conversion; they require high-efficiency, low-noise, and smart-monitored transformers capable of handling harmonic distortion caused by variable frequency drives (VFDs), power electronics, and automated robotic lines.
International procurement trends demonstrate a sharp shift toward suppliers who can provide custom engineered step-up and step-down transformers with minimal lead times without sacrificing compliance with international standards such as IEC 60076, IEEE, and GOST-R. Key performance indicators now focus on reducing no-load losses ($P_0$) and load losses ($P_k$), maximizing short-circuit withstand capabilities, and ensuring total phase balance across three-phase systems.

Every single transformer—whether a compact household 600VA isolation unit or a massive 1250kVA oil-immersed distribution transformer—undergoes full Factory Acceptance Testing (FAT). Routine tests include winding resistance measurement, voltage ratio verification, phase vector check, short-circuit impedance evaluation, and high-voltage dielectric withstand testing in accordance with IEC and GOST protocols.

In Samara’s extensive petrochemical plants, transformers must withstand corrosive airborne gases and ambient heat. Henan Pirooz Power supplies hermetically sealed oil-immersed transformers equipped with flame-retardant insulating liquids and explosion-proof terminal boxes to guarantee continuous processing operation.
Automotive plants require isolation transformers to eliminate voltage spikes and electrical noise caused by high-power resistance welding units. Our customized 3-phase isolation transformers step down voltage while isolating heavy power fluctuations, protecting robotic control units.
For municipal utilities retrofitting older district power networks in Samara, our dry-type cast resin transformers (SCB13 series) offer fire-safe, self-extinguishing operation inside European-style compact substations without risk of oil leaks.
